Revenue Analysis
Autodesk reported a total net revenue of $6.131 billion for the fiscal year ending January 31, 2025, showing a robust increase from $5.497 billion in FY 2024 and $5.005 billion in FY 2023. This consistent growth signals strong demand for its software solutions across various sectors, particularly in design and engineering.
- Revenue Breakdown:
- Architecture, Engineering, and Construction: $2.937 billion
- AutoCAD products: $1.572 billion
- Manufacturing sector sales: $1.189 billion
- Media and Entertainment: $315 million
The upward trajectory reflects Autodesk's effective marketing strategies and product enhancements, enabling it to capture a larger share of the market.
Profitability Metrics
The net income for FY 2025 reached $1.112 billion, marking a significant increase from $906 million in FY 2024 and $823 million in FY 2023. The diluted EPS rose to $5.12, indicating enhanced profitability and efficient cost management.
- Operating Expenses:
- Marketing and Sales: Increased to $1.670 billion
- Research and Development: Grew to $1.181 billion, reflecting Autodesk's commitment to innovation.
Despite the rising costs, the improved revenue significantly outpaced these expenses, leading to enhanced margins.

Strategic Acquisitions
Autodesk's aggressive growth strategy includes several key acquisitions:
- Aether Media, Inc.: For $131 million, aimed at enhancing AI capabilities in its VFX tools.
- Payapps Limited: Acquired for $387 million, which strengthens its Autodesk Construction Cloud platform.
These acquisitions are expected to bolster Autodesk's technological offerings and market position, indicating a strategic pivot towards integrating advanced technologies into its products.
Tax Position and Deferred Tax Assets
Autodesk's net deferred tax assets stand at $1.381 billion after accounting for a valuation allowance. The presence of substantial deferred tax assets provides Autodesk with flexibility to manage future tax liabilities effectively.
- Tax Credits: The company holds significant tax credits, including $130 million from California for R&D, which can offset future taxable income.
Lease Obligations and Future Commitments
Autodesk reported operating lease costs of $6 million in FY 2025, down from $8 million in FY 2023. The significant reduction in leasing costs reflects efficient space management and potential downsizing of physical office space in light of remote work trends.
